Transaction 1179cb1c893e8e46aab892c853759f91aaa145b7e61ae0962a780e06003eb528
2 Input
2 Outputs
- 1179cb1c893e8e46aab892c853759f91aaa145b7e61ae0962a780e06003eb528:0
- 1179cb1c893e8e46aab892c853759f91aaa145b7e61ae0962a780e06003eb528:1
value 675002
address 1FTZUuhahRpg5HV36AS91vnVhj5azcvy5E
value 1520366
address 367hXAbdSshqzwBzyJyZ8nC23j9UYBrzqi